Description

There is a county cement drainage canal that funnels water under Wesleyan drive there is also a drain pipe that funnels water from the ditch that goes underneath Hillbrooke Ct, these two drains connect into a large drain pipe that runs underneath my yard, I'm not sure exactly what the problem is but apparently it is busted because my yard is flooded. This flooding began right after the last long hard frees and snow/ice storm we had here in Macon. I have reported this three times by phone to the city and count starting 1 month ago, I was told each time someone would call me and come out to investigate.
